Transaction 625d2898b2d4c8556e14137712a1ae674c3515ddfa3765427c0fab6d538ea092
1 Input
1 Output
-
625d2898b2d4c8556e14137712a1ae674c3515ddfa3765427c0fab6d538ea092:0
- value
- 86418625
- script pubkey
- OP_0 OP_PUSHBYTES_20 3dcf326edb3d332cc725285a53d735979ac1eb41
- address
- bc1q8h8nymkm85eje3e99pd984e4j7dvr66p35lzrt